FBIU4D7M1.......FBIU4G7M1
4.0 Amp. Glass Passivated Ultrafast Bridge Rectifiers
Dimensions in mm.
IN LINE 7M1
Voltage 200 V to 400 V
Current 4.0 A
Glass passivated chip junction Ideal for printed circuit board Reliable low cost construction Plastic material has Underwriters Laboratory
Flammability Classification 94V-0
High case dielectric strength of 2000 VRMS Isolated voltage from case to lead over
2500 volts
MECHANICAL DATA
Case: Molded plastic Terminals: Leads solderable
per MIL-STD-750, Method 2026 Weight: 0.15 ounce, 4 grams Mounting torque: 5 in. Ibs. max.
